Glens Falls, NY - The
Adirondack Phantoms have announced that they are
accepting nominations for the second class of the
Adirondack Hockey Hall of Fame presented by Glens
Falls National Bank featuring new, enhanced fan
participation in the decision process.
Fans may suggest up to six Adirondack hockey greats
for consideration by sending an e-mail to Phantoms
Vice President Mike Thompson at mthompson@phantomshockey.com.
After the finalists are selected, the fans will
be a part of the final vote to determine who will
be inducted.
Any man or woman who has helped advance or promote
the sport of hockey at any level in the North Country
is eligible to be nominated. This includes players,
coaches, media or fans and other supporters from
youth hockey all the way up to the professional
level.
Those selected will be honored during Adirondack
Hockey Hall of Fame Night presented by Glens Falls
National Bank which will take place on March 12.
The induction ceremony will be held during a pregame
reception in Heritage Hall and the 2011 class will
be honored on the ice in festivities throughout
that evening's Phantoms game.
The 2010 inaugural class included legendary Adirondack
Red Wings Head Coach Bill Dineen, Red Wings players
Greg Joly and Glenn Merkosky, and Glens Falls Civic
Center director Ned Harkness who was largely responsible
for the construction of the arena and the arrival
of AHL hockey in Glens Falls.

The Adirondack Hall of Fame selection committee
is comprised of hockey historians, former professional
players and hockey executives, media members and
youth hockey organizers. The selection committee
is currently made up of six voting members. The
seventh vote belongs to the fans as they will get
to cast their ballot on phantomshockey.com or the
Phantoms Facebook page.
